So people might wonder why he was charged with affray rather than intentional injury.

That’s because Article 7 of “Interpretations on Several Issues Concerning the Application of Law for Handling Cases of Criminal Affray” by the two high [courts] has specific provisions.

If the conduct constitutes the offense of affray as well as intentional homicide, intentional injury, intentional destruction of property, extortion, robbery, or larceny, the punishnt should be in accordance with the cri that incurs a more severe penalty.

Intentional injury resulting in minor injuries is usually punishable by less than three years, but affray is punishable by up to five years, so he was charged with affray, as Old Tang could see from the prior judgnt.

The court held that Huang Licheng’s preparatory act of carrying a knife, which resulted in one person receiving minor injuries and two others receiving slight injuries, was affray.
